Q:   What is Bhavan's College cutoff?
A: 

 Bhavan's College cutoff 2026 was released up to round 2 for admission to several UG-level courses for the AI quota categories. 

For the General AI category, the overall cutoff ranged from 42.67 to 83.5 for the BCom, BSc, BMM, BMS and other courses. Among all, the least and the most competitive were B.Com. in Accounting and Finance and  Bachelor of Arts (B.A.), respectively. 

The list below contains the overall cutoff range for all other All India categories.

  • OBC: 45 - 71.67
  • SC: 36 - 59
  • EWS: 60
  • ST: 53.67 - 75.75
Q:   What is K.P.B Hinduja College of Commerce cutoff for General category?
A: 

K.P.B Hinduja College of Commerce cutoff 2026 for the first round ranged between 60 and 89.4 for students belonging to the General AI quota. Candidates can refer to the table below to view the course-wise cutoff percentage in the General AI quota.  

CourseRound 1 Cutoff 2026 
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.)77.8
B.Com. in Accounting and Finance89
B.Com. in Financial Markets89.4
B.Com. in Investment Management60.5
B.Sc. in Information Technology60
B.A. in Multimedia and Mass Communication86.33
Q:   What is the KES Shroff College of Arts and Commerce Cutoff?
A: 

KES Shroff College of Arts and Commerce Cutoff 2026 was released up to round 2 for admission to BCom and BSc courses and their various branches. 

For the General AI category, the round 2 cutoff ranged from 35 to 83.83, wherein B.Sc. in Information Technology and B.Com. In Certified Management Accounting, were the least and most preferred courses for admission.

Students can refer to the table below to know the course-wise round 2 cutoff range. 

CourseKES Shroff College of Arts and Commerce Cutoff 2026
B.Sc. in Information Technology35
B.Sc. in Data Science35
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.)38.83
B.A. in Film, Television and New Media Production42.83
B.Sc. in Artificial Intelligence44
B.Com. in Investment Management46
B.Com. in Financial Markets46.33
Bachelor of Management Studies46.5
B.Com. in Banking and Insurance49.83
B.Com. in Digital Business51.17
B.Sc. in Cyber Security and Digital Forensics61.33
B.Sc. in International Finance61.33
B.Sc. in Fashion Technology69.2
B.Com. in Certified Management Accounting83.83

Note: The cutoff will vary accordingly. 

Q:   Is there any need-based scholarships at K J Somaiya College of Science and Commerce?
A: 

Yes, there are need-based scholarships at K J Somaiya College of Science and Commerce. The scholarships are offered to students coming from financially disadvantaged backgrounds who wish to pursue education. The college offers scholarships thorugh private scholarship bodies. The need-based scholarships are as mentioned below:

  1. Smt. Sakarbai K Somaiya Scholarship
  2. Smt. Mayadevi S Somaiya Memorial Scholarship

To acquire the scholarships, candidates must priovide must demonstrate proven financial need and submit additional documents during application or interview process.

Q:   What is the Ghanshyamdas Saraf College of Arts and Commerce cutoff 2026?
A: 

The Ghanshyamdas Saraf College of Arts and Commerce cutoff 2026 was published for admission to various UG-level courses for the All India categories. 

For the General AI category, the overall cutoff ranged from 51.33 to 70, wherein B.Com. in Accounting and Finance was the toughest course for admission. 

Candidates can refer to the table below to know the course-wise round 2 cutoff details for this category. 

Course2026
B.Com. of Management Studies (BMS)55.17
B.Com. in Accounting and Finance70
B.Com. in Banking and Insurance51.33
B.Com. in Financial Markets64.67
B.Sc. in Information Technology60.17

Q:   What is the SIES College of Commerce and Economics Cutoff?
A: 

For the General AI category, the SIES College of Commerce and Economics Cutoff 2026 ranged from 52.5 to 85 for the BCom and BSc courses and the various branches. 

The cutoff has only been released for the 1st round of admissions for the All India category. So, General AI category students have to attain a percentile of at least 52.5 to be considered for a seat. Refer to the table below to know the cutoff required for each course, sorted from least to most competitive.

CourseRound 1 (Closing Rank)
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.)52.5
B.Sc. in Information Technology53
B.Sc.in Artificial Intelligence53
B.Com. in Banking and Insurance62
B.Com. in Accounting and Finance84
B.Com. in Financial Markets85

Note: The cutoff for other categories will be different. 

Q:   What is the M.L. Dahanukar College of Commerce cutoff?
A: 

For M.L. Dahanukar College of Commerce cutoff 2026 in the first round, the cutoff percentage varied between 35 and 77.83 for students belonging to the General AI quota. For the course-wise first cutoff list, check out the table below: 

CourseRound 1 Cutoff 2026
B.Com. in Accounting and Finance77.83
B.Com. in Banking and insurance70.67
B.Sc. in Information Technology35
B.Com. in Financial Markets76
Bachelor of Mass Media (BMM)48.17
Bachelor of Management Studies (BMS)48.5
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.)60
B.Sc. in Data Science45
B.Com. in Business Administration64.5
B.Com. in Logistics and Supply Chain Management46.83
B.Sc. in Artificial Intelligence45
Q:   What is the eligibility criteria for BCom course admissions at MMK College of Commerce and Economics?
A: 

Students who want to get admission into BCom course at MMK College of Commerce and Economics, must pass class 12 with a recognised board. The minimum marks required to get a shortlist is 50%. There must not be backlogs in any of the subjects. Students must submit documents like mark sheet, migration certificate, and passport size photo.

Q:   What is the St. Andrew's College of Arts, Science and Commerce cutoff 2026 for BCom?
A: 

St. Andrew's College of Arts, Science and Commerce BCom cutoff 2026 was released across multiple specialisations. For Round 1, the cutoff percentages ranged between 46.17 and 83.17 in the General category. Check out the table below to view the branch-wise cutoff percentage for the students belonging to the General AI quota for BCom admission. 

CourseMumbai University Cutoff 2026
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.)46.17
B.Com. in Banking and Insurance68.17
B.Com. in Accounting and Finance83.17
